AI-Driven Process Optimization Solutions for Enhanced Business Performance

Frequently Asked Questions

AI-driven process optimization services use artificial intelligence to analyze workflows, identify inefficiencies, and suggest data-backed improvements. These services help organizations streamline operations, reduce costs, and boost productivity through intelligent automation and predictive analytics.

By leveraging real-time data, machine learning algorithms, and advanced analytics, AI-driven optimization services uncover hidden bottlenecks and automate decision-making. This leads to faster workflows, reduced errors, and measurable ROI across multiple departments.

Industries such as manufacturing, logistics, healthcare, finance, and retail gain significant value. AI can optimize supply chains, automate routine tasks, and enhance resource allocation, leading to smarter operations and higher efficiency.

Yes, small businesses can benefit greatly. Many providers offer scalable AI-driven process optimization services tailored to smaller teams and budgets. Even minor process improvements can lead to substantial time and cost savings for small enterprises.

AI can optimize a wide range of processes including customer service workflows, supply chain logistics, IT operations, HR management, financial forecasting, and quality control. Essentially, any data-driven process can be improved with AI insights.
